express相关内容
我在使用 fetch 中的 post 方法时遇到问题,因为我的服务器正在从客户端接收一个空对象.我已在客户端签入,无法发送我要发送的值. 这是我的服务器: const express = require('express');常量应用程序 = 快递();const bodyParser = require('body-parser');const mysql = 要求('mysql');a
..
尝试将 blob 对象发送到我的节点服务器.在客户端,我正在使用 MediaRecorder 录制一些音频,然后我想将文件发送到我的服务器进行处理. saveButton.onclick = function(e, audio) {var blobData = localStorage.getItem('recording');控制台.log(blobData);var fd = new Fo
..
我正在尝试使用 fetch on react 来实现客户端登录. 我正在使用护照进行身份验证.我使用 fetch 而不是常规 form.submit() 的原因是因为我希望能够从我的 express 服务器接收错误消息,例如:“用户名或密码错误". 我知道护照可以使用 flash 消息发回消息,但 flash 需要会话,我想避免使用它们. 这是我的代码: fetch('/log
..
我有一个使用 react 的前端设置和一个使用 express 和 mongodb 制作的后端,我有一个组件需要发出一个获取请求,其中包括应该已经设置好了.所有路线都适用于邮递员,但我无法使用 fetch 功能重新创建功能.快递服务器: ...server.use(头盔());server.use(压缩());server.use(cors({凭据:真实,}));如果(process.env.N
..
当我尝试在前端使用 fetch 并在后端使用快速路由发送发布请求时,我收到 TypeError: Failed to fetch 错误-结束. 我能够在数据库中成功创建新用户,但是当尝试通过 fetch promise 获取新用户数据时,就会抛出错误. app.js 函数 createNewUser() {让 formUsername = document.getElementByI
..
router.get('/productSelect', (req, res, next) =>{productSchema.aggregate([{ $查找:{来自:'supplierSchema',localField: 'supplierId',外国字段:'_id',如:'供应商'}}], (err, productSchema) =>{如果(错误) res.json(错误);否则 res.
..
我目前正在使用 Express 和 Sequelize + MySQL,我想知道解决这个问题的最佳方法是什么.如果这是一个基本问题,我深表歉意,因为我对 Sequelize 甚至 SQL 数据库都很陌生. 我有一个像这样的模型User; 导出默认 db.define('User', {ID: {类型:Sequelize.INTEGER,允许空:假,主键:真,自动增量:真,},名称: {类型
..
/assets/?tags[]=foo&tags[]=bar 对上述端点的获取请求应该只返回那些包含所有提供的标签(foo,bar)的记录 我当前的尝试是返回与任何给定标签匹配的任何记录. const { tags } = req.query;重新发送(等待资产.findAll({where: whereOptions,包括: [{ 模型:AssetMime },{型号:标签,如:'标签
..
我使用 Sequelize 作为我的节点 js 应用程序和 Mysql 数据库的 ORM,在遵循一些教程后,我添加了此代码以将 mysql 连接到节点,但在录制 npm start 后,我收到此错误:无法连接到数据库:{ SequelizeConnectionRefusedError: connect ECONNREFUSED 127.0.0.1:3306 const Sequelize
..
我希望有人可以帮助我.我正在为 express.js 使用 Sequelize ORM,并且我在 2 个表之间有一个有效的多对多关系. 为了简化我的查询,假设我的表是用户、书籍和用户书籍,其中用户书籍有用户 ID、书籍 ID 和一个附加列(假设它的 NoOfTimesRead). 我想做的是这样的: user.getBooks({在哪里: {“userBooks.NoOfTimesR
..
我正在尝试保存续集模型及其关联.所有的关联都是一对一的.从数据库中检索具有关联的模型可以正常工作,但插入它们是另一回事,文档只是让我更加困惑. 这是我的插入方法: 模型.radcheck.创建用户, {包括:[{model:models.skraningar},{model:models.radusergroup},{model:models.radippool}]}).then(成功,错
..
sequelize中是否可以根据路由改变数据库连接? 例如,用户可以访问网站中的 2 个不同的安装:- example.com/foo- example.com/bar 登录后,用户会被重定向到 example.com/foo要获取 foo 站点的所有任务,他们需要访问 example.com/foo/tasks bar 站点使用单独的数据库,因此如果他们想获得 bar 的所有任
..
在 Sequelize 中,我使用了这个函数 model.destory({ truncate: true }),它会删除表中的所有数据.但问题是它不会重置表中应该设置为零的主键序列.我正在使用Mysql.有人说Mysql会自动重置主键序列,但在我的情况下没有发生. 这是我的代码: db.Booking.destroy({ truncate: { cascade: false } }).t
..
据我所知,在sequelize中,定义外键有两种方式. 首先,使用 references 比如: sequelize.define('foo', {bar_id:{类型:'blahblah',参考: {型号:酒吧,键:'id'}}}); 其次,使用belongsTo方法: Foo.belongsTo(Bar, { foreignKey: 'bar_id', targetKey: 'id
..
我一直收到此续集错误 /node_modules/sequelize/lib/sequelize.js:508this.importCache[path] = defineCall(this, DataTypes);^类型错误:defineCall 不是函数在 module.exports.Sequelize.import (/node_modules/sequelize/lib/sequeli
..
我在尝试将我的应用程序部署到 Heroku 时陷入了一个循环.由于“无法在 Common JS 中加载 ES6 模块",我的导入语句(例如 import cors from 'cors')似乎阻止了应用程序在生产中启动.错误.在本地它运行得很好. 但是,当我尝试通过将 "type": "module" 添加到我的 package.json 来解决上述错误时,我得到了一组全新的错误,应用程序将
..
我正在尝试使用 Sequelize 迁移更新我的数据库,因此我尝试编写这样的 Sequelize 迁移 '使用严格';模块.exports = {up: (queryInterface, Sequelize, migration) =>{queryInterface.addColumn('coaching_class_entries', 'bill_cycle', {类型:Sequelize.I
..
寻找一种使用 Sequelize Model.bulkCreate 将活动批量插入数据库的方法. 不确定如何将活动从视图带到路由函数,以便使用 bulkCreate 插入它们.现在我只插入一个活动. 查看:
计划名称
..
我在模型文件夹中有 4 个模型(artisans、stores、items 和 itemStores),但它只将 items 模型加载到 db 变量中.为什么会这样? server.js var express = require('express');var app = express();var bodyParser = require('body-parser');var db =
..
使用 Sequelize ORM 我正在尝试更新字段 level_id,其中该字段与另一个名为 level_tbl 的表中的字段 Level 有一个外键. select * from level_tbl;+----------+----------+|level_id |水平 |+----------+----------+|1 |更高 ||2 |普通 |+----------+-----
..